Transaction 24a9334677b509ed60143c80bcbaee3933888059492f1f68730804fa39381234
1 Input
2 Outputs
- 24a9334677b509ed60143c80bcbaee3933888059492f1f68730804fa39381234:0
- 24a9334677b509ed60143c80bcbaee3933888059492f1f68730804fa39381234:1
value 718945
address 16CfC6wvPjHJAJUn9Ny3FHsYozxNNAPEV3
value 45793648
address 1BFHJnbNFZQwkiWzr47dwsvh7AwdBammnK